Weblate is an open-source translation management system for localizing software. It integrates with version control systems such as Git, includes automated quality checks, and can be used as a cloud service or self-hosted.
Lokalise is a localization platform for translating software, websites, mobile apps, and other digital content. It offers AI translation, collaborative translation workflows, and developer tooling such as an API, CLI, and mobile SDKs.
